Litigation 80%

I am recognized by Best Lawyers in America, Missouri-Kansas SuperLawyers, and Best of the Bar for my expertise in Business & Commercial Litigation, Antitrust, Intellectual Property Litigation, and Bet-the-Company Litigation. I am a member of the Bars of Missouri and Kansas, and the Western District of Missouri and the District of Kansas federal courts. Subspecialties include presenting and challenging expert witnesses in a variety of scientific and professional areas, and damage claims.

Antitrust and Trade Law 5%

I have tried to verdict both civil and criminal antitrust cases. I argued and won an antitrust standing case before the United States Supreme Court. I acted as one of the lead counsel in multiparty antitrust litigation. I have also tried unfair competition, tortious interference, RICO and trademark infringement cases.

White Collar Crime 5%

The site's name for this topic is unfortunate. My practice includes white collar criminal defense; I do not practice white collar crime. In addition to trying an antitrust prosecution, a tax evasion case, an extortion case, and a bank robbery, I persuaded a Court to dismiss a theft of trade secrets case and persuaded a federal prosecutor to drop a bank fraud case against a client. I also represent witnesses and businesses in criminal investigations and in responding to subpoenas.
